Abstract

The invention discloses an augmented reality display method and device, relating to the technical field of optics and comprising the following steps: receiving signal source identification information; associating the signal source identification information with content information to generate associated information, wherein the associated information is used for representing the association relationship between the signal source identification information and the content information; and sending the content information and the associated information to a user. The technical scheme disclosed by the invention can be used for pushing the specific content information to the user in a targeted manner, and the user is prevented from receiving and displaying a large amount of redundant content information irrelevant to the user.

Background
The purpose of augmented reality displays is to achieve a visual overlay of virtual information with real information. The observer can directly watch the virtual information displayed by the display device by wearing the augmented reality display device, and simultaneously, the observer can directly observe the external environment through the display device, so that the virtual information and the real world are superposed.
The augmented reality display device needs to display the virtual information on the display device separately, so that the observer can visually recognize that the virtual information is perfectly integrated with the real space. However, when the virtual information pushed by the content source is large, the content information observed by the observer through the augmented reality display device is disordered, and the content information cannot be effectively screened and displayed.

The embodiment of the invention discloses an augmented reality display method, as shown in figure 1, comprising the following steps:
s101, receiving signal source identification information;
s102, associating the signal source identification information with the content information to generate associated information, wherein the associated information is used for representing the association relationship between the signal source identification information and the content information;
and S103, sending the content information and the associated information to the user.
The signal source includes an object that can emit a broadcast signal, the broadcast signal may include a visual signal, such as a visible light image, or may include a non-visual signal, such as an infrared image, and the user may receive the signal emitted by the signal source through an augmented reality display device worn by the user.
The signal emitted by the signal source comprises signal source identification information. Alternatively, the signal source may include an identification number, and the identification number may be a fixed number or a temporarily assigned number, and further, the identification number may have uniqueness or uniqueness within a specific range. The signal source identification information may carry an identification number of the signal source for distinguishing from other signal sources.
The embodiment of the present invention does not limit the manner of receiving or sending information, and may exemplarily include a mobile communication network, a wireless local area network, bluetooth, or other various optional technical solutions.
In S101, the signal source identification information may be received by capturing an image, acquiring a visible light image, an infrared image, or the like.
In S102, the content information may include content information locally generated or stored by the augmented reality display device, or may include content information received by the augmented reality display device and generated or stored by another device. And the augmented reality display device associates the received signal source identification information with the content information and generates associated information, wherein the associated information is used for representing the association relationship between the signal source identification information and the content information. Since the signal source identification information has uniqueness, the signal source identification information can be uniquely associated with the content information.
In S103, the content information and the associated information are sent to the user, and particularly, when a plurality of users exist in the area or the network and the plurality of users need to receive different content information, the associated information may indicate the content information that the users need to receive to the user, so as to avoid the users from receiving irrelevant content information.
The technical scheme disclosed by the embodiment of the invention can be used for pushing the specific content information to the user in a targeted manner, and the user is prevented from receiving and displaying a large amount of redundant content information irrelevant to the user.
In addition, the user also desires that specific content information be displayed at a corresponding position accurately when viewing the content information through the augmented reality display device. Generally, the display position of the content information can be obtained by means of completely depending on the operation of a processor, but is not accurate and reliable.
Optionally, before sending the content information to the user, the method may further include:
and S104, sending display setting information to the user, wherein the display setting information comprises display position information, and the display position information is used for indicating the display position of the content information.
For example, as shown in fig. 2, the guide may install a signal source on the top of a banner of the guide and transmit display setting information indicating a display position of content information, i.e., a virtual reality area, to the user. The tourist can see the content information displayed in the virtual reality area moving along with the tour guide through the augmented reality display device along with the travel of the tour guide, and the content information can comprise related information about the explanation of the tour guide to the scenic spot.
Optionally, S101 may further include:
s1011, receiving the signal source identification information, including receiving a plurality of signal source identification information, where the association information may be used to represent an association relationship between the plurality of signal source identification information and the content information.
For example, as shown in fig. 3, in a game played by multiple players, such as a chess or a card game, a plurality of fixed signal sources may be placed on a chess or card table, for example, one signal source is placed at each of four corners of the chess or card table. The display setting information is sent to the user, the display position of the content information can be indicated to be the chess and card table, and further, the display position can be in the area enclosed by the four signal sources. For table games, the position marking of content information needs higher precision, such as the position of a chessman, and the traditional calibration mode based on image recognition and background operation cannot realize real-time high-precision display. The technical scheme disclosed by the embodiment of the invention can be used for solving the complex situation, for example, two parties play table tennis with the assistance of an augmented reality display device, and the embodiment of the invention can also greatly reduce the calculation amount required by position calibration on the basis of ensuring the precision.
Illustratively, during a speech, a speaker can attach a patch-type signal source to 4 vertices of a rectangular white board, and establish a virtual information display area according to the positioning of four corners of the rectangular white board, and an augmented reality display device of an audience can display content information in the virtual information display area corresponding to the position of the white board according to received position information. Because of the quadrangular positioning, the positioning of the position during the display is more accurate, for example, when the speaker indicates the corresponding position in the virtual information display area with a marking tool, a laser pointer, a baton, or the like, there is no deviation in the position of the marking object in the field of view of the listener.
Optionally, S103 may further include:
s1031, receiving an authentication request sent by a user;
s1032, according to the authentication request, the content information and the associated information are sent to the user.
The disclosed content information without authority can be sent to each user without authentication. However, for non-public content information, it should be transmitted only to the user with access right, so the right assignment should be performed to the user, and the user authentication should be performed before transmitting the content information.
Optionally, the allocation mode of the access right is not limited in the present invention. In the embodiment of the invention, the host of the augmented reality display equipment receives an authentication request sent by a user, confirms the access authority of the user according to the received authentication request, and sends content information and associated information to the user for the user with the access authority passing the authentication, otherwise, does not send the content information and the associated information.
The technical scheme disclosed by the embodiment of the invention can complete the pushing of the content information of multiple users in an augmented reality scene, and can also perform static or dynamic calibration on the display position of the content information, so that the positions of the content information observed by different users at the same time can be accurately matched.
